How Much Is the Average Cost of Car Insurance in Massachusetts?
The average cost of car insurance in Massachusetts is around $1700 for full coverage, which is quite less than the national average. Similarly, the minimum coverage rate in Massachusetts is also quite less than the national average and is around $500 annually. Who Offers the Best Car Insurance Rates in Massachusetts?
When looking for the best car insurance rates in Massachusetts, several companies stand out based on different criteria such as affordability, customer satisfaction, and specific needs like handling driving violations.
- State Farm is one of the most affordable options, offering an average annual premium of $689 for full coverage auto insurance rates. This makes it a top choice for those looking for low-cost insurance​​.
- GEICO: GEICO is known for competitive rates and good coverage options. It offers an average annual premium of $1,269. It is ranked well for drivers with speeding tickets and DUIs, and the insurance provider offers lower rates compared to many other insurers​​.
- Mapfre: Mapfre is noted for having fewer customer complaints and providing a good mix of coverage options and discounts. This makes it a solid choice for those who prioritize customer service and reliability​.
What is the Average Cost of Minimum Liability Coverage in Massachusetts?
Minimum liability coverage is a mandatory requirement for all car owners in Massachusetts. This basic insurance protects passengers and others on the road in case of an accident. On average, the cost of minimum liability coverage in Massachusetts is about $35 per month, which totals approximately $424 annually. While this coverage meets the state’s legal requirements, it may not cover all expenses in serious accidents, so it’s important to assess your needs carefully.
The Average Cost of Full Coverage Car Insurance in Massachusetts
Full coverage car insurance offers more extensive protection, combining liability, collision, and comprehensive coverage to safeguard you and your vehicle. In Massachusetts, the average cost of full coverage car insurance is around $1,700 per year, or roughly $150 per month. This policy helps cover damages to your car from collisions, theft, or natural disasters, giving you greater peace of mind on the road.
Factors That Influence Car Insurance Cost in Massachusetts
Car insurance can be a significant expense, especially for lower-income families, so it’s important to understand what affects your premium rates. Insurance providers consider several factors when determining the cost of car insurance in Massachusetts. Here are some of the key influences:
- Location: Where you live matters. Areas with heavy traffic, higher population density, or more frequent accidents tend to have higher insurance premiums.
- Age, Gender, and Driving History: Younger drivers and males typically face higher rates due to statistically higher risk. A clean driving record can help lower your costs.
- Credit Score: A strong credit score often leads to better premium rates, as insurers see it as a sign of responsible behavior.
- Vehicle Type: The make and model of your car also impact your insurance costs. Cars with advanced safety features may lower premiums, while luxury or high-performance vehicles usually increase them due to higher repair and theft risks.
Understanding these factors can help you make informed decisions and find the best value when shopping for car insurance in Massachusetts.
Massachusetts Car Insurance Rates by City
Car insurance rates in Massachusetts vary significantly by city due to differences in traffic, population density, and local risk factors. Here’s a city-by-city look at the average full coverage premium rates across major Massachusetts cities:
City | Full coverage rate per month | Full coverage rate per year |
Leverett | $108 | $1296 |
Richmond | $118 | $1413 |
Worcester | $171 | $2057 |
Andover | $119 | $1426 |
Boston | $170 | $2037 |
Newton | $131 | $1577 |
North Dartmouth | $144 | $1729 |
Northampton | $114 | $1363 |
Beverly | $127 | $1521 |
Monponsett | $141 | $1693 |
Nantucket | $116 | $1395 |

Massachusetts Car Insurance Rates by Vehicle Type
The type of vehicle you drive has a significant impact on your car insurance in Massachusetts. Safer vehicles like the Honda Odyssey typically cost around $1,400 annually, while luxury sedans often exceed $2,000 per year. Premiums for minivans, pickup trucks, and other vehicles generally fall between these ranges. Choosing a car without expensive imported parts can help keep your insurance costs lower.
